How many gens of Ryzen are there?

While there have been five generations of Ryzen CPUs, there have been six series in total — 1000, 2000, 3000, 4000, 5000, and 6000. That's because AMD used the last Zen 3 architecture for two series — 4000 and 5000.

Is Ryzen 3 better than i7?

The Ryzen 3 3100 showed up in the more recent Geekbench 5 benchmark. The quad-core processor put up single-and multi-core scores of 1,141 points and 4,928 points, respectively. The Core i7-7700K scored 1,284 points and 5,168 points in the single-and multi-core tests, respectively.

Is Ryzen 3 faster than i3?

AMD Ryzen 3 vs Intel Core i3: Performance

Overall the Intel Core i3-12100 provided a much better 28.8% higher performance than the single-core score of AMD Ryzen 3 in Cinebench R23. Even in multi-core scores, the scales tipped in favour of Intel with 26% better performance than the Ryzen 3 3300X.

What does Ryzen 3 mean?

Ryzen 3 (pronounced Rye-Zen) is a family of low-end performance 64-bit quad-core x86 microprocessors introduced by AMD in late-2017. Ryzen 3 is based on the Zen microarchitecture and is manufactured on GF's 14 nm process. Ryzen 3 is marketed toward the low-end performance market.
